Our house will be finishing renovations and be ready to move in by the
end of July 2011. The best time for us to move in planning wise is in
August, however this is also the 7th hungry ghost month.
Can we
symbolically move in before the 7th month eg. by boiling water and
leaving some items in the house - and then actually move in some time in
August? Or will moving in august still be bad luck?
Would it help if we chose an auspicious date in August to move?
Thank you!

Posted
  • Staff

These are some considerations:
1. The most important key consideration is: how desperate one is to move-in?
2. For example, if one has no constrains such as "forced" to move on or the 7th lunar month; then try to move-in after that month.
3. But, if one no choice; then to play safe; the act of sleeping in the new home would be a better choice.
4. Thus, if you can or may do all the things; but also sleep one night (or place a set of both partner's night clothing on each side of the bed) and also try to cook (and if can bathe, sleep and cook) would be an added bonus before the 7th month.
